| Decent Energy, Inc., has been informed that EnergyWorks KC (EWKC) will be providing certain additional rebates to incent energy efficiency improvements to commercial buildings within Kansas City, MO. The enhanced rebate is only available to buildings located within Kansas City, MO. Program eligiblity requirements apply.
EWKC is funded by the U.S. Department of Energy under its Better Buildings grant progam. Our understanding is that through EWKC the City of Kansas City Missouri plans to enhance roughly four hundred fifty (450) commercial energy efficiency improvement projects.
The EWKC Commercial program provides a rebate towards implementation of recommended improvements, a low cost implementation loan (of up to $15,000), and a rebate for the commercial assessment (audit). In the right situations, implementing the recommended package of improvements can be cash flow positive when all of the rebates, financing and savings are taken into account.
